Treatment protocol Poplar wood stems were cut into 0.5 mm wafers on a microtome, sterilized for 20 min at 121°C, dried at 50°C overnight, and cooled to room temperature. The specimens were then inoculated in Petri dishes with actively growing mycelia. Approximately 5 g of wood wafers were placed in each Petri dish (exact weights were recorded), sealed and incubated at 22°C and 70 ± 5% relative humidity for 10, 20 or 30 days (time points: 10, 20 and 30, respectively). Following incubation, the wafers were removed from the Petri dishes, immediately snap-frozen in liquid nitrogen and stored at -80°C for later use. For substrates “A” and “B”, three(1) replicates were used for each substrate/fungus and incubation period combination. For substrate “C” only 2 biological replicates were employed. (1)One of the tree replicates of substrate B after 10 days failes, therfore only 2 replicates were used .
Growth protocol P. placenta was cultured on malt extract agar (MEA) (Oxoid, UK) for 10 days prior to inoculation with wood wafers.

Extraction protocol Frozen wood wafers with fungal mycelia were ground to a fine powder with liquid nitrogen in an acid washed, pre-chilled mortar and pestle. Total fungal RNA was purified as previously described by Vanden Wymelenberg et al 2010 (Appl Enviro Microbiol 76:3599-3610).

Data processing The raw data (.pair file) was subjected to RMA (Robust Multi-Array Analysis), quantile normalization , and background correction as implemented in the NimbleScan software package, version 2.4 (Roche NimbleGen, Inc.).
